DOWNLOAD THIS NOW: Massive Attack, “Four Walls (Burial Remix)”

Since Massive Attack‘s lavish, insanely limited Burial collab is already out of print, we thought we’d rescue you from eBay scalpers and post the A-side below. “Four Walls” is a groove-engulfing version of a previously unreleased track from Massive Attack’s Heligoland sessions, and while the following MP3 isn’t dusted with gold glitter, it’ll have to do for now…

PRIMER: Massive Attack

(L to R: Robert "3D" Del Naja, Grant "Daddy G" Marshall)

[Photo by Hamish Brown]

Blue LinesMassive Attack‘s debut album, and one of trip-hop’s first blunted blueprints—turns 20 next year (20!), which got us thinking: why don’t we ask the group’s one consistent member, Robert “3D” Del Naja, to talk about their entire back catalog? A lovely idea until we got the guy talking…and only made it as far as Mezzanine.

Good thing Massive Attack’s first three full-lengths are all essential listens in their own right, starting with…
